Read each sentence to find out whether there is any
grammatical error in it. The error, if any, will be in one part of the sentence. Mark the part with the error as your answer. If there is no error, mark ‘No error’ as your answer (Ignore the errors of punctuation, if any). The Principal, along with the teachers, (A) / have inspected the examination halls (B) / to ensure proper arrangements (C) / for the board exams. (D) / No error (E)Solution
When the subject is followed by "along with," the verb must agree with the main subject — in this case, "The Principal" (singular). So, "have" should be replaced with "has."
Correct sentence: The Principal, along with the teachers, has inspected the examination halls to ensure proper arrangements for the board exams.
